    So I went to our local track a couple weeks ago, and ran my car at the dragstrip. It kinda sucks, and everyone says that you never run your best there. Not that I'm trying to make an excuse or something, I ran what I ran. I got a total of 9 runs in, but here are a few worth mentioning.

    My only mods are APR100 stage 2, Ecode test pipe, QTP exhaust dump, K&N filter with custom heat shield. Ran no spare tire, and put on the stock conti tires (about 30% tread left) @ 50psi so they would slip and grab at the track. They worked perfectly even though half bald. So here's what I ran:

    Best run:
    Reaction time: -.041 (just barely red-lighted it )
    60ft time: 1.903
    1/4mi: 14.064 @ 95.743mph

    Decent run, but I would have expected you to be solidly into the 13s given the APR100 flash and assuming you had good 100 octane fuel. Some other questions to answer might be: what was the temperature, relative humidity level, barometric pressure, traction conditions and ASL elevation at the time of the run?

    Although I'm new to the 2.0T engine with no intent to drag the A4, I cannot help but think of how my Porsche Turbo reacts at the track; with street tires on the 930, I never got below mid 11s and saw a variability of ~1.5 secs between fastest runs from different days throughout the year all at the same track but with different temperatures. Turbo engines generally react the same way to external temp/pressure variation.

    I was running my APR100 program, but I had a tad over half of a tank of fuel. I only had about 3gal left of the MS109 I run, so in reality I had half a tank of about 97 octane if the gas was as good as it says. Like I said, if I am better prepared with less gas and run higher octane, I know I can hit the 13.7-13.9 range. It will depend on how good my driving has become as to how consistent those 13 second runs are.

    Quote Originally Posted by gpultro View Post
    How did you launch what RPM's and did you drop it or feather it out, also what was your tire presure at
    Stated in first post, but I ran the stock Conti tires that were balding at about 50psi.

    As for launching, feathering did not work for me. I can get it sometimes, but my first two runs were both 14.4 seconds because feathering resulted in me just spinning the clutch.

    How I ended up launching it to get perfect launches every time, is:
    1. Make sure tires have a high amount of air pressure
    2. Turn off ESP
    3. I revved it up between 3,000-3,200rpm (hard to keep it in one spot, so go for about 3.2)
    4. Completely dump the clutch, then floor it.

    This gave me pretty much perfect (I could work on the 60ft times) almost every run, but you have to figure out when to dump it to get the good reaction time.

    The first time I just dumped the clutch, I was pissed so I revved it to about 4,000rpm on my third run. Dumped the clutch, did a friggin burnout, and the whole car torqued to the right so I had to counter steer once I caught and started going. hahaha it was fun, but 4,000rpm was too high to launch at with the tires I had on.
